25
what do metals that react with oxygen produce
metals react with oxygen to produce metal oxides metal + oxygen -> metal oxide
26
what is an oxidation reaction
one where a substance gains oxygen
27
example of an oxidation reaction including sodium
sodium + oxygen -> sodium oxide 4Na + O2 -> 2Na2O
28
example of an oxidation reaction involving copper
copper + oxygen -> copper oxide 2Cu + O2 -> 2CuO
29
what is a reduction reaction
one where the substance looses oxygen
30
metals more reactive than hydrogen react with what
metals more reactive than hydrogen react with dilute acids
31
when metals more reactive than hydrogen react with dilute acid what is produce
a salt and hydrogen gas
32
what is the word equation for metals (more reactive than hydrogen)reacting with dilute acid
metal + acid -> salt + hydrogen
33
what happens when you react potassium and sodium with acid
explosive reaction occurs that should not be carried out in schools
34
what happens when calcium is reacted with acid
reacts violently to give hydrogen gas
35
what happens when magnesium is reacted with acid
reacts rapidly to give hydrogen gas
